☐ Step 7 — Verify undo/redo integrity in DiagraFlow before sealing the signing key. The reviewer confirms that undoing a shape deletion and redoing it produces an identical canvas hash, and that the history stack is cleared before the ceremony export. Once both witnesses initial this step, the editor state is frozen. The recovery passphrase for the ceremony archive follows below.

unlock words, yawig-kagef: gordor-holvan-ulaael-pramir-ulaiel-tamdor

**Ticket: Relevance tuning notes — sign-off needed**

The search relevance tuning notes for Querrel 5 are drafted, covering synonym weighting and the new plugin scoring hooks. Plugin authors: review section 3 before building against the beta API. Changes are frozen pending sign-off. No merges to the ranking config until approval lands from the person below.

account owner for bawip-tahag: Raleth Quenok

Ticket: Config drift on user-service split (Helmswood cluster)

While carving the user module out of the Bramblecore monolith, we found the extracted user-service running with settings that diverge from what's in the deploy repo — session TTL and the auth callback differ on two of three nodes. This likely explains the intermittent logout reports. On-call: please reconcile the nodes against the canonical values, which should read as follows.

settings of yageg-yahap:
[gorael]
team = olieth
access_code = ac_941d74
owner = brieth.aldiel
host = gorael.tolvaqio.internal
port = 6379
peer = briwyn.urlaqtech.internal
salt = 116e6622
pin = 1957

Leadership Review Briefing — Proposed Joint Venture

Norvale Instruments has proposed a joint venture with Quellis Marine to co-develop sensor arrays for coastal monitoring. Due diligence is underway; initial findings on Quellis's order book are favourable. Sales leads should prepare territory impact assessments before the review. The commercial rationale is set out in the confidential note below.

management briefing: Project Ulavan slips by two quarters because of the staffing delay.